Voting Component
The Voting Component will be conducted across five (5) weeks ("Weekly Periods"). Each published Page will have a voting feature, whereby individuals will be able to submit a vote for the Page of the entrant whose Unique Page URL they followed during a Weekly Period. The two (2) entrants whose Pages receive the most valid votes in each Weekly Period will each win the prize outlined in the table below corresponding to that Weekly Period ("Weekly Prize"). In the event of a tie for any Weekly Prize between multiple entrants who receive the same highest number of votes (other than between the first and the second placed entrants, excluding Week 5), each tied entrant will need to provide a response to Intel as to why they deserve to win the relevant Weekly Prize. Intel will then rank the entrants based on how good their response is (based on originality and creativity) in order to award the relevant Weekly Prize(s). No chance will be involved in how the winners in the Voting Component are determined.

Entries and votes during each Weekly Period will open at 12:00am AEST and close at 11:59pm AEST on the dates outlined in the table below, with the exception of the first Weekly Period where entries will open at 2:00pm AEST. At the start of each Weekly Period, the votes received for each published Page will be reset to zero and each Page will be put up for voting in each Weekly Period occurring after the Page is first published (with the exception of any Page that belongs to a winner of a Weekly Prize in an earlier Weekly Period). Each entrant can win a maximum of one (1) Weekly Prize. Votes are limited to one (1) vote per person. No prizes will be awarded for the act of voting in this Contest. Draw Component

A random draw for all entries placed into the Draw Component during the Contest Period will be conducted at Anisimoff Legal, Level 5, 492 St Kilda Rd, Melbourne VIC 3004, on 04/07/2013 at 10:00am AEST. The first valid entry drawn will win a $10,000 Harvey Norman voucher (that can be used toward an office makeover) and a HP Elitebook Revolve 810 Business Tablet valued at $2,199. Total prize pool value of the Draw Component is $12,199. Intel may draw additional reserve entries and record them in order in case an invalid entry or ineligible entrant is drawn.

The Draw Component prize will be awarded to the owner of the respective winning Eligible Business. Any ancillary costs associated with redeeming the Harvey Norman voucher are not included. Any unused balance of the Harvey Norman voucher will not be awarded as cash. Redemption of the Harvey Norman voucher is subject to any terms and conditions of the issuer including those specified on the Harvey Norman voucher.

A redraw for the Draw Component prize, if unclaimed, may take place on 04/10/2013 at the same time and place as the original draw, subject to any directions from a regulatory authority.
